Jong Il Park is a distinguished researcher whose work lies at the intersection of medical robotics and image-guided surgery, with a particular focus on advancing spinal fusion procedures. His most notable contribution is the development of an image-guided robotic surgery system for spinal fusion, detailed in his 2006 paper, which has garnered 38 citations. This system integrates real-time imaging with robotic precision to enhance the accuracy and safety of spinal surgeries, addressing critical challenges such as screw placement and minimally invasive techniques.
